Malaysians who voted on March 8th, 2008 both made an indelible mark on Malaysian history and forever became a part of it.
In over fifty incisive articles supported with revealing polling data, this book provides insight into what generated this unprecedented tsunami, and the new political landscape that is still unfolding in front of our eyes.
An all star cast of commentators that include prominent politicians, analysts and figures from civil society are brought together to piece together the puzzle that was March 8th and ponder on a new era free from political hegemony.
The unchartered waters of Malaysia's new future are mapped out, while writers reveal the hidden forces behind the scenes that converged to produce unforgettable electoral results.
